Class BotConfiguration
Inheritance
System.Object
BotConfiguration
Assembly: Syn.Bot.dll
Syntax
public class BotConfiguration : ViewModelBase
Constructors
BotConfiguration()
Declaration
public BotConfiguration()
Properties
BotId
Declaration
public string BotId { get; set; }
Property Value
Type |
Description |
System.String |
|
CheckIntentNames
Declaration
public bool CheckIntentNames {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
ContextLifespan
Declaration
public int ContextLifespan { get; set; }
Property Value
Type |
Description |
System.Int32 |
|
EnableCaching
Declaration
public bool EnableCaching {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
EnableContextUndo
Declaration
public bool EnableContextUndo {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
EndToEndEncryption
Declaration
public bool EndToEndEncryption {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
IntentNameProvider
Declaration
public IntentNameProvider IntentNameProvider { get; set; }
Property Value
MainUserId
Declaration
public string MainUserId { get; set; }
Property Value
Type |
Description |
System.String |
|
MaxIntentCount
Declaration
public int MaxIntentCount { get; set; }
Property Value
Type |
Description |
System.Int32 |
|
MaxUserIdleInterval
Declaration
public TimeSpan MaxUserIdleInterval { get; set; }
Property Value
Type |
Description |
System.TimeSpan |
|
RemoveContextOnFallback
Declaration
public bool RemoveContextOnFallback {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
RemoveIdleUsers
Declaration
public bool RemoveIdleUsers {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
RenderMissingVariable
Declaration
public bool RenderMissingVariable {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
ReplaceResponseVariable
Declaration
[Obsolete("No longer supported. Variables are always replaced by their respective values.")]
public bool ReplaceResponseVariable {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
RequiredRecognizersOnly
Declaration
public bool RequiredRecognizersOnly {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
Scoring
Declaration
public ScoreConfiguration Scoring { get; }
Property Value
ShowIntentInterpretation
Declaration
public bool ShowIntentInterpretation {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
StoreUserHistory
Declaration
public bool StoreUserHistory {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
UseFullIntentName
Declaration
public bool UseFullIntentName {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
UserHistoryLimit
Declaration
public int UserHistoryLimit { get; set; }
Property Value
Type |
Description |
System.Int32 |
|